The city of Riihimäki made a strategic choice when it launched the Define ecosystem (Defence Innovation Network Finland) three years ago. The idea behind it was simple: the growth of cities is built on existing strengths. As a city, we are putting our cards in the bag so that the current operations of the Riihimäki garrison and the new NATO unit provide the best ingredients for Finland's growth in the form of new innovation activities, new companies and jobs. So I send my greetings to the writers of the government program next spring: in the upcoming government program, the Define operation must be secured a national financial position and a special task as an international innovation center and testing platform for dual-use technology.
The success story of Finnish innovations can be repeated in the security and defense sector
In the early 2000s, Finland created the world's most competitive research, development and innovation model, based on close cooperation between companies, universities and research institutes. The competitive advantage came from the ability of Nordic culture to remove barriers between companies and public actors. Now it is time to repeat Finland's innovation success story in the security and defence sector.
In the old world, the military sector was the engine of innovation development, whose inventions were transferred to the benefit of civilian society. The world's most advanced technologies and solutions are now created in the joint development and innovation activities of companies, military organizations and research institutes. This guiding principle guides the development of the Define ecosystem initiated by Riihimäki. A report commissioned by the Ministry of Defense from spring 2023 also came to the same conclusion. “Radical technologies and national security: Is Finland ready for the challenge?”.
Strong cooperation with NATO already in Riihimäki
Having a new NATO unit in our city is a wonderful continuation of the projects that started in Riihimäki at the beginning of 2026. For the core functions of the Defence Forces Artificial Intelligence Centre and the Innovation UnitIn December 2025, we will host Riihimäki for the first time NATO Innovation Range Technology Demonstration event, where 17 growth companies from the alliance region and Ukraine tested their own technologies on NATO command systems. Within the framework of Define, we are also involved in future Innovation Range events, the next of which will be in Latvia in May 2026.
In a week, the fourth Define business acceleration program will be launched at Riihimäki Veturitalle. In the program, we also work closely with With the NATO Diana accelerator managed by VTT. By the end of 2025, we have successfully accelerated a total of 36 startups. Of these companies, more than ten have received capital investment, three have made a successful exit, and several have signed commercial agreements with more established (prime) companies in the defense industry or the Finnish Defense Forces. These companies have generated more than a hundred new jobs.
Finnish Independence Day Fund In January, Sitra decided to fund the nationalization of the Define network with two years of co-financing.Our network includes all the most significant defense innovation players nationally, from Espoo to Joensuu, from Oulu to Tampere. Internationally, we have cooperation agreements with innovation ecosystems in the Nordic countries, the Baltics, and the state of North Carolina in the United States.
The Management Systems Unit concretizes Define's vision
The high-tech communications unit, employing sixty people, strengthens the position of the city of Riihimäki as a traditional garrison town for communications. Above all, it concretizes Define's vision. Already three years ago, in April 2023 I dared to say out loud that we are building a world-class defense network and also aiming for NATO structures related to command systems in our city.In addition to our vision, our determined and systematic work is based on a clear operational idea, or mission: to create dual-use technologies that serve military organizations and civilian society, improve the defense capabilities of Finland and NATO, strengthen Europe's strategic self-sufficiency, and accelerate the growth of our companies.
When in mid-February The Minister of Defense described the arrival of a NATO unit in Finland to YLE as good news., as mayor, I can state that yesterday's location decision feels like a victory for the entire Kanta-Häme region. I would like to congratulate the Finnish government on achieving the NATO goals and at the same time warmly thank the Minister of Defence and the entire Defence Administration for their trust in the city of Riihimäki and the entire Kanta-Häme region. Special thanks also go to our constituency MP and member of the Defence Committee, Timo Heinonen, for our cooperation in the process.
Getting a management system unit in Riihimäki is a historic, turning point in the development of a city with just under thirty thousand inhabitants.
